Era:Edo period
Kikyoku is one of the tea utensils used in Sencha tea ceremony.
This is a red lacquer Kikyoku box.
This box is used for displaying or storing sencha utensils.
The word "Iseya" is written in Kanji on the side.
On the other side, "Iseya" is written in hiragana.
This is a trade name used by many merchants from Ise.
There is a family crest on the front, but it is illegible.
The four corners of the box are made of old Edo period iron supporting the box firmly.
Today, it can be displayed as is but can also be used for various storage purposes.
